I'm upgrading from 2.0.13 to 2.1.2 and I followed all the directions and when I sent my first message, I got this:
> ----- Transcript of session follows ----- > Group mismatch error. Mailman expected the mail > wrapper script to be executed as group "mailman", but > the system's mail server executed the mail script as > group "other". Try tweaking the mail server to run the > script as group "mailman", or re-run configure, > providing the command line option `--with-mail-gid=other'. > 554 5.3.0 unknown mailer error 2 I ran configure the same way as before, and I put the new "mailman" program in my sm.bin ... % ls -l mailman wrapper 2 lrwxrwxrwx mailman -> /new/mailman/mail/mailman* 2 lrwxrwxrwx wrapper -> /old/mailman/mail/wrapper* % ls -lL mailman wrapper 74 -rwxr-sr-x 1 root mailman 37732 Sep 13 10:19 mailman* 72 -rwxr-sr-x 1 root mailman 36096 Aug 31 2002 wrapper* This has been working fine. Any ideas?
